Ed Moore, CEO and founding partner of 116 & West advertising agency, joins Prater & The Ballgame to discuss the concept behind the latest Kendall Auto Group TV commercial, "The Boys are Back in Town," featuring football icons Leighton Vander Esch, Kellen Moore and Chris Petersen.